National Fitness Day at Cygnet Hospital Kewstoke

To mark National Fitness Day on 22nd September, the team at Cygnet Hospital Kewstoke created a new activity called ‘Exercise Bingo’. Active Life Lead, Sally Leddy, supported by members of the OT team, took Exercise Bingo to each of the five wards.

Sally devised the game herself after realising that bingo was very popular. In her version each number equated to an exercise, so when a number was called, participants checked their card and then took part in the exercise associated with that number. Exercises included, among others, star jumps, leg raises, side steps, front and back crawl, lateral raises, high knees, leg swings and calf raises.

There were prizes for the first people to complete a full line on their card and for a full house. There was good engagement on each ward and service users enjoyed the activity so much that they have requested further sessions.
